# Lookahead Safety

The single most common bug in quant research with LLMs: using data that
was not yet known at the moment you claim to have known it. This skill
defines the rules to keep historical analysis honest.

## The core rule

**The known-date is the date a piece of information was PUBLISHED, not the
date the information is ABOUT.**

- A 10-K covering fiscal year 2023 may be filed in March 2024.
  In January 2024, that 10-K **did not exist**.
- An S-3 effective on 2024-04-15 was unknown on 2024-04-14.
- An XBRL `SharesOutstanding` datapoint with `period_end: 2023-12-31`
  is known only after the filing that contains it is published.

When asked to compute or recommend anything `as of` a date `D`, only data
where `filing_date <= D` is admissible.

## Field-by-field reference for SEC data

| Field | Use as known-date? | Notes |
|-------|---------------------|-------|
| `filing_date` / `acceptedDate` | ✅ YES | The publication moment |
| `period_end` / `periodOfReport` | ❌ NEVER | The accounting period the data covers |
| `effectiveDate` (S-3, etc.) | ✅ YES | When the registration becomes usable |
| `reportDate` on XBRL facts | ❌ NO | Period covered, not publication |
| `accepted` timestamp | ✅ YES | Most precise — use when intra-day matters |

## Common traps

1. **The XBRL trap.** `companyfacts.json` returns datapoints keyed by
   `period_end`. Naively iterating these as a time series leaks future
   information — the datapoint with `period_end: 2023-12-31` was first
   published months later. Always join with the originating filing's
   `accepted` date and treat THAT as availability.

2. **The amendment trap.** A 10-K/A (amendment) supersedes the original 10-K
   but is filed later. At time `D` between the original and the amendment,
   only the original was known. Don't apply restated numbers to dates
   before the amendment's `filing_date`.

3. **The "as of today" trap in backtests.** When using current data
   (e.g., `current_shares_outstanding`), confirm whether the source
   provides a point-in-time history or only the current snapshot.
   A snapshot is unsafe for any historical query.

4. **The price-data trap.** Adjusted prices are computed using SPLIT
   factors from splits that may not have happened yet at date `D`. Use
   raw OHLC + a split history table where each split has its own
   ex-date as the cutoff.

5. **The earnings-revision trap.** Restated earnings (a later 10-K/A
   correcting a previous 10-K) were unknown until restatement. Backtests
   that use the latest version of earnings for old dates are fictional.

## Workflow when the user asks "what was X on date D"

1. Identify the data source (XBRL, filings, prices, derived metrics).
2. Determine the source's publication semantics (when did this datapoint
   become observable to a market participant?).
3. Filter by `publication_date <= D`. If publication is unknown,
   **stop and tell the user the query is unsafe**.
4. State explicitly which `as_of_date` was used and which records were
   excluded for being future-dated.

## Workflow when writing backtest code

- Every read of historical state must take a `query_date` argument and
  filter on `filing_date <= query_date` (or equivalent).
- Never store "current" values in a structure used for historical lookup.
- When in doubt, prefer the EARLIEST plausible publication date over the
  latest — bias toward under-claiming what was knowable.
- Tests: include a "future-data leak" test that fails if any record with
  `filing_date > query_date` is returned by a historical query.

## What this skill is NOT

This is not a forecasting or prediction skill. It does not tell you what
will happen. It tells you what you were ALLOWED to know at a moment in
time. Use it before any historical reasoning. Combine with domain skills
(SEC filing types, dilution events) for full coverage.
